mirror of
https://github.com/LmeSzinc/StarRailCopilot.git
synced 2024-11-23 09:01:45 +00:00
Fix: 修复登录
This commit is contained in:
parent
ccc4a889ca
commit
4e58edadbd
@ -9,7 +9,7 @@ class LoginHandler(Combat):
|
|||||||
def handle_app_login(self):
|
def handle_app_login(self):
|
||||||
logger.hr('App login')
|
logger.hr('App login')
|
||||||
|
|
||||||
confirm_timer = Timer(2)
|
confirm_timer = Timer(1)
|
||||||
while 1:
|
while 1:
|
||||||
self.device.screenshot()
|
self.device.screenshot()
|
||||||
|
|
||||||
@ -30,11 +30,11 @@ class LoginHandler(Combat):
|
|||||||
if self.info_bar_count() and self.appear_then_click(LOGIN_CHECK, interval=0.5):
|
if self.info_bar_count() and self.appear_then_click(LOGIN_CHECK, interval=0.5):
|
||||||
logger.info('Login success')
|
logger.info('Login success')
|
||||||
if self.appear(MAIN_CHECK):
|
if self.appear(MAIN_CHECK):
|
||||||
confirm_timer.start()
|
if confirm_timer.reached():
|
||||||
|
|
||||||
if confirm_timer.started() and confirm_timer.reached():
|
|
||||||
logger.info('Login to main confirm')
|
logger.info('Login to main confirm')
|
||||||
break
|
break
|
||||||
|
else:
|
||||||
|
confirm_timer.reset()
|
||||||
|
|
||||||
return True
|
return True
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user